What means Po in Filipino?

Filipinos would add a word before the first name to show respect to anyone older than them. Some very basic and common words for showing respect are po and opo. They both basically mean “yes” in a respectful way but used differently in sentences.

Why do Filipinos call each other po?

Po is used to show respect when speaking or called by someone older or a person with authority. Also use po when saying salamat, or "thank you". If you are called by someone older than you (such as your mom, dad, uncle, auntie, or an elderly neighbor), you should answer po.

What is the meaning of Salamat po?

“Salamat! / Salamat po!” This means “thank you” in Tagalog / Filipino. Whenever you receive something, it is what you say. And, if someone gives you thanks, you reply with “Walang anuman,” the Filipino equivalent of “You're welcome.”

How do you say sorry in Tagalog?

There is no word for "sorry" or "apology." When Filipinos are at fault, they say in Tagalog or Filipino, "Pasensiya na." That literally translates into, "Please forget your anger" or "Please let it go".

How do you greet a Filipino?

When greeting strangers, a soft handshake accompanied with a smile is common among men. Among women, a smile and a hand wave is the usual greeting. Close friends and family may accompany a handshake with a pat on the back. Females may hug and kiss to greet each other.

Where did po and opo come from?

Po/Opo is a sign of respect and we've been taught to say the words to the elderly. Po is a contraction of Apo (accented on the first syllable) so whenever we say “Ano po iyon?” we're actually saying “Ano, apo, iyon?” The word apo means lord so saying po is a sign of submission and “Opo, panginoon” is redundancy.

What is OPO in Tagalog?

Definition for the Tagalog word opo:

opò [adverb/interjection] yes (polite); yes sir/ma'am; Short for "Oo po"

How do you reply to kumusta?

“How are you, sir/madam?” Kumusta po kayo? Responses to "How Are You?" You can respond to these expressions by saying “mabuti”, which means “fine” in English.
